EC2インスタンスにJava 8をインストールできるかどうかを誰かが知っているのではないかと思っていました。私のアプリケーションは、Jettyが埋め込まれたファットjarとしてパックされているため、Java 8ランタイムだけで十分です。
私はLinuxにあまり詳しくありませんが、デフォルトのAMIではJava 7しかサポートされていませんでした。 Java 8に更新するために実行できる簡単なコマンドはありますか?
check Java現在のバージョン
Java -version
インストールJava 1.8
Sudo yum install Java-1.8.0
Javaバージョンを変更する
Sudo alternatives --config Java
JDK 8のインストール:
ステップ1:Javaバージョンを確認する
Java -version
ステップ2:Oracle JDKのRPMパッケージをダウンロードする(8u121)
wget --no-check-certificate --no-cookies --header "Cookie: oraclelicense=accept-
securebackup-cookie" http://download.Oracle.com/otn-pub/Java/jdk/8u141-
b15/336fa29ff2bb4ef291e347e091f7f4a7/jdk-8u141-linux-x64.rpm
ステップ4:JDK 8をインストールする
Sudo yum install -y jdk-8u141-linux-x64.rpm
ステップ5:Oracle JDKバージョンを確認する
Java -version
JRE 1.8のインストール
Sudo yum install Java-1.8.0
Javaバージョンを変更する
Sudo alternatives --config Java